iOS 6 was announced onĀ September 12, 2012 at San Francisco’s Yerba Buena Center for the Arts together with iPhone 5 and iPod Touch 5th-Gen. iOS 6 is already available to download for a week now but older iPhones and iPad are no longer supported by this update. Supported devices on this release are iPhone 3GS, iPhone 4 and 4S, iPad 2, new iPad, fourth and fifth generation iPod Touches.

iOS 6 update

Google Maps and Youtube has been removed from iOS 6. Apple created a new Maps app with new vector-based engine that eliminates lag when downloading bitmaps from Google hat result to smoother zooming. It also has 3D views, turn-by-turn navigation and ability to zoom out in Satellite mode to see the Globe. There are many improvements and new in messaging, fast and reliable SIRI and preventing targeted advertising using Limit Ad Tracking in settings.
